Virgílio Almeida has received the inaugural edition of the UNESCO–Uzbekistan Beruniy Prize for Scientific Research on the Ethics of Artificial Intelligence (AI) for his work on using digital technologies for the public good. “This prize carries profound symbolic meaning for our time—an era marked by turbulence, yet also by hope and the enduring power of the humanities to guide us in the age of AI,” said Almeida.
